Small Business Saturday was started by American Express in 2010 when small businesses were reeling from the recession and they wanted to encourage people to support small businesses (by using their American Express cards no doubt). In 2011, the U.S. Senate unanimously passed a resolution in support of the day and a movement was born.
And what a successful movement it’s been: in 2018, $17.8 billion was spent on Small Business Saturday. How amazing is that? Hopefully, 2019 will build and surpass last year’s Small Business Saturday.
